Transaction 389763df0893bcc990fa8486d9bbd52909fde98ae7dc33f3e60a07dcc827c077

2 Input
2 Outputs
  • 389763df0893bcc990fa8486d9bbd52909fde98ae7dc33f3e60a07dcc827c077:0
  • value  2232196
    address  1Cxvcepk8sjeMZ8PunA4TN1D5JsEG2NuhJ
  • 389763df0893bcc990fa8486d9bbd52909fde98ae7dc33f3e60a07dcc827c077:1
  • value  2818868
    address  3BVfhhxoJfTLNRKrCGUQ8CcWhFKWj3CG38